Strategy Senior Associate, Asset Management

Chicago, IL, United States

About Northern Trust:

Northern Trust, a Fortune 500 company, is a globally recognized, award-winning financial institution that has been in continuous operation since 1889.

Northern Trust is proud to provide innovative financial services and guidance to the world’s most successful individuals, families, and institutions by remaining true to our enduring principles of service, expertise, and integrity. With more than 130 years of financial experience and over 22,000 partners, we serve the world’s most sophisticated clients using leading technology and exceptional service.

Role Summary

The Strategy Senior Associate will be responsible for conducting business and industry analysis to support strategic initiatives and decision making across Northern Trust Asset Management. Reporting directly to the Head of Strategy for NTAM, the Senior Associate will drive projects in areas most relevant to the business strategic agenda.

Primary Duties and Responsibilities

Work collaboratively with leadership team to set key business strategic priorities, articulate detailed strategic plans with specific deliverables and measurable outcomes on a range of critical topics

Drive the transformation agenda of the business and support the development of organic and inorganic growth plans, operational and profitability goals

Evaluate market and industry developments and potential competitor moves, and translate research into impact to the business and recommended strategic responses

Support strategic and tactical planning for Asset Management, identifying cross-functional strategic initiatives and supporting the development and alignment of functional strategies

Conduct research in support of strategic topics and initiatives and distill complex topics into crisp PowerPoint presentations that communicate the key messages

Identify the best data sources and develop ad-hoc queries and analysis to deliver key insights in support of strategic initiatives

Perform business and competitor data analytics to support management decision making, identify insights and make recommendations

Develop OKRs and KPIs that enable the business to measure and provide transparency on progress against strategic priorities

Support Asset Management’s articulation of strategy and future impact to the firm’s Board of Directors

Foster well prepared, engaged and action oriented executive team meetings and offsites on key topics that advance NTAM business priorities

Necessary Knowledge and Skills

Strong consultative skills ranging from analytics, strategy development, influencing, facilitation and consensus building

Ability to identify key primary and secondary data sources and utilize data-driven insights to effectively improve business decisions and provide clarity

Advanced analytical and financial modeling skills, with ability to organize, structure and process moderate to large sets of data efficiently and effectively into meaningful and actionable insights

Expert user of PowerPoint and Excel, including modeling and data manipulation required

Experience with data manipulation and visualization tools such as Alteryx, Tableau, Power BI highly desirable

Ability to translate strategies into actionable and quantitative plans, defining metrics and KPI’s to gauge the progress of strategic initiatives

High degree of comfort dealing with ambiguity; comfort in a dynamic and fast paced work environment

Dynamic relationship building and partnership skills; a strong collaborator with experience leading initiatives across multiple groups and stakeholders

Outstanding communication skills, both written and verbal, with demonstrated ability to develop materials and effectively present to and persuade executive audiences

Necessary Experience and Education

Bachelor’s degree; Master in Business Administration and/or CFA preferred

At least three+ years of work experience in corporate strategy or as a management consultant

Asset management industry experience and product knowledge highly preferred; Financial Services experience required
